/library/src/main/java/me/grantland/widget/AutofitHelper.java: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| package me.grantland.widget;
2 |
3 | import android.content.Context;
4 | import android.content.res.Resources;
5 | import android.content.res.TypedArray;
6 | import android.os.Build;
7 | import android.text.Editable;
8 | import android.text.Layout;
9 | import android.text.StaticLayout;
10 | import android.text.TextPaint;
11 | import android.text.TextWatcher;
12 | import android.text.method.SingleLineTransformationMethod;
13 | import android.text.method.TransformationMethod;
14 | import android.util.AttributeSet;
15 | import android.util.DisplayMetrics;
16 | import android.util.Log;
17 | import android.util.TypedValue;
18 | import android.view.View;
19 | import android.widget.TextView;
20 |
21 | import java.util.ArrayList;
22 |
23 | /**
24 | * A helper class to enable automatically resizing {@link TextView}`s {@code textSize} to fit
25 | * within its bounds.
26 | *
27 | * @attr ref R.styleable.AutofitTextView_sizeToFit
28 | * @attr ref R.styleable.AutofitTextView_minTextSize
29 | * @attr ref R.styleable.AutofitTextView_precision
30 | */
31 | public class AutofitHelper {
32 |
33 | private static final String TAG = "AutoFitTextHelper";
34 | private static final boolean SPEW = false;
35 |
36 | // Minimum size of the text in pixels
37 | private static final int DEFAULT_MIN_TEXT_SIZE = 8; //sp
38 | // How precise we want to be when reaching the target textWidth size
39 | private static final float DEFAULT_PRECISION = 0.5f;
40 |
41 | /**
42 | * Creates a new instance of {@code AutofitHelper} that wraps a {@link TextView} and enables
43 | * automatically sizing the text to fit.
44 | */
45 | public static AutofitHelper create(TextView view) {
46 | return create(view, null, 0);
47 | }
48 |
49 | /**
50 | * Creates a new instance of {@code AutofitHelper} that wraps a {@link TextView} and enables
51 | * automatically sizing the text to fit.
52 | */
53 | public static AutofitHelper create(TextView view, AttributeSet attrs) {
54 | return create(view, attrs, 0);
55 | }
56 |
57 | /**
58 | * Creates a new instance of {@code AutofitHelper} that wraps a {@link TextView} and enables
59 | * automatically sizing the text to fit.
60 | */
61 | public static AutofitHelper create(TextView view, AttributeSet attrs, int defStyle) {
62 | AutofitHelper helper = new AutofitHelper(view);
63 | boolean sizeToFit = true;
64 | if (attrs != null) {
65 | Context context = view.getContext();
66 | int minTextSize = (int) helper.getMinTextSize();
67 | float precision = helper.getPrecision();
68 |
69 | TypedArray ta = context.obtainStyledAttributes(
70 | attrs,
71 | R.styleable.AutofitTextView,
72 | defStyle,
73 | 0);
74 | sizeToFit = ta.getBoolean(R.styleable.AutofitTextView_sizeToFit, sizeToFit);
75 | minTextSize = ta.getDimensionPixelSize(R.styleable.AutofitTextView_minTextSize,
76 | minTextSize);
77 | precision = ta.getFloat(R.styleable.AutofitTextView_precision, precision);
78 | ta.recycle();
79 |
80 | helper.setMinTextSize(TypedValue.COMPLEX_UNIT_PX, minTextSize)
81 | .setPrecision(precision);
82 | }
83 | helper.setEnabled(sizeToFit);
84 |
85 | return helper;
86 | }
87 |
88 | /**
89 | * Re-sizes the textSize of the TextView so that the text fits within the bounds of the View.
90 | */
91 | private static void autofit(TextView view, TextPaint paint, float minTextSize, float maxTextSize,
92 | int maxLines, float precision) {
93 | if (maxLines <= 0 || maxLines == Integer.MAX_VALUE) {
94 | // Don't auto-size since there's no limit on lines.
95 | return;
96 | }
97 |
98 | int targetWidth = view.getWidth() - view.getPaddingLeft() - view.getPaddingRight();
99 | if (targetWidth <= 0) {
100 | return;
101 | }
102 |
103 | CharSequence text = view.getText();
104 | TransformationMethod method = view.getTransformationMethod();
105 | if (method != null) {
106 | text = method.getTransformation(text, view);
107 | }
108 |
109 | Context context = view.getContext();
110 | Resources r = Resources.getSystem();
111 | DisplayMetrics displayMetrics;
112 |
113 | float size = maxTextSize;
114 | float high = size;
115 | float low = 0;
116 |
117 | if (context != null) {
118 | r = context.getResources();
119 | }
120 | displayMetrics = r.getDisplayMetrics();
121 |
122 | paint.set(view.getPaint());
123 | paint.setTextSize(size);
124 |
125 | if ((maxLines == 1 && paint.measureText(text, 0, text.length()) > targetWidth)
126 | || getLineCount(text, paint, size, targetWidth, displayMetrics) > maxLines) {
127 | size = getAutofitTextSize(text, paint, targetWidth, maxLines, low, high, precision,
128 | displayMetrics);
129 | }
130 |
131 | if (size < minTextSize) {
132 | size = minTextSize;
133 | }
134 |
135 | view.setTextSize(TypedValue.COMPLEX_UNIT_PX, size);
136 | }
137 |
138 | /**
139 | * Recursive binary search to find the best size for the text.
140 | */
141 | private static float getAutofitTextSize(CharSequence text, TextPaint paint,
142 | float targetWidth, int maxLines, float low, float high, float precision,
143 | DisplayMetrics displayMetrics) {
144 | float mid = (low + high) / 2.0f;
145 | int lineCount = 1;
146 | StaticLayout layout = null;
147 |
148 | paint.setTextSize(TypedValue.applyDimension(TypedValue.COMPLEX_UNIT_PX, mid,
149 | displayMetrics));
150 |
151 | if (maxLines != 1) {
152 | layout = new StaticLayout(text, paint, (int)targetWidth, Layout.Alignment.ALIGN_NORMAL,
153 | 1.0f, 0.0f, true);
154 | lineCount = layout.getLineCount();
155 | }
156 |
157 | if (SPEW) Log.d(TAG, "low=" + low + " high=" + high + " mid=" + mid +
158 | " target=" + targetWidth + " maxLines=" + maxLines + " lineCount=" + lineCount);
159 |
160 | if (lineCount > maxLines) {
161 | // For the case that `text` has more newline characters than `maxLines`.
162 | if ((high - low) < precision) {
163 | return low;
164 | }
165 | return getAutofitTextSize(text, paint, targetWidth, maxLines, low, mid, precision,
166 | displayMetrics);
167 | }
168 | else if (lineCount < maxLines) {
169 | return getAutofitTextSize(text, paint, targetWidth, maxLines, mid, high, precision,
170 | displayMetrics);
171 | }
172 | else {
173 | float maxLineWidth = 0;
174 | if (maxLines == 1) {
175 | maxLineWidth = paint.measureText(text, 0, text.length());
176 | } else {
177 | for (int i = 0; i < lineCount; i++) {
178 | if (layout.getLineWidth(i) > maxLineWidth) {
179 | maxLineWidth = layout.getLineWidth(i);
180 | }
181 | }
182 | }
183 |
184 | if ((high - low) < precision) {
185 | return low;
186 | } else if (maxLineWidth > targetWidth) {
187 | return getAutofitTextSize(text, paint, targetWidth, maxLines, low, mid, precision,
188 | displayMetrics);
189 | } else if (maxLineWidth < targetWidth) {
190 | return getAutofitTextSize(text, paint, targetWidth, maxLines, mid, high, precision,
191 | displayMetrics);
192 | } else {
193 | return mid;
194 | }
195 | }
196 | }
197 |
198 | private static int getLineCount(CharSequence text, TextPaint paint, float size, float width,
199 | DisplayMetrics displayMetrics) {
200 | paint.setTextSize(TypedValue.applyDimension(TypedValue.COMPLEX_UNIT_PX, size,
201 | displayMetrics));
202 | StaticLayout layout = new StaticLayout(text, paint, (int)width,
203 | Layout.Alignment.ALIGN_NORMAL, 1.0f, 0.0f, true);
204 | return layout.getLineCount();
205 | }
206 |
207 | private static int getMaxLines(TextView view) {
208 | int maxLines = -1; // No limit (Integer.MAX_VALUE also means no limit)
209 |
210 | TransformationMethod method = view.getTransformationMethod();
211 | if (method != null && method instanceof SingleLineTransformationMethod) {
212 | maxLines = 1;
213 | }
214 | else if (Build.VERSION.SDK_INT >= Build.VERSION_CODES.JELLY_BEAN) {
215 | // setMaxLines() and getMaxLines() are only available on android-16+
216 | maxLines = view.getMaxLines();
217 | }
218 |
219 | return maxLines;
220 | }
221 |
222 | // Attributes
223 | private TextView mTextView;
224 | private TextPaint mPaint;
225 | /**
226 | * Original textSize of the TextView.
227 | */
228 | private float mTextSize;
229 |
230 | private int mMaxLines;
231 | private float mMinTextSize;
232 | private float mMaxTextSize;
233 | private float mPrecision;
234 |
235 | private boolean mEnabled;
236 | private boolean mIsAutofitting;
237 |
238 | private ArrayList mListeners;
239 |
240 | private TextWatcher mTextWatcher = new AutofitTextWatcher();
241 |
242 | private View.OnLayoutChangeListener mOnLayoutChangeListener =
243 | new AutofitOnLayoutChangeListener();
244 |
245 | private AutofitHelper(TextView view) {
246 | final Context context = view.getContext();
247 | float scaledDensity = context.getResources().getDisplayMetrics().scaledDensity;
248 |
249 | mTextView = view;
250 | mPaint = new TextPaint();
251 | setRawTextSize(view.getTextSize());
252 |
253 | mMaxLines = getMaxLines(view);
254 | mMinTextSize = scaledDensity * DEFAULT_MIN_TEXT_SIZE;
255 | mMaxTextSize = mTextSize;
256 | mPrecision = DEFAULT_PRECISION;
257 | }
258 |
259 | /**
260 | * Adds an {@link OnTextSizeChangeListener} to the list of those whose methods are called
261 | * whenever the {@link TextView}'s {@code textSize} changes.
262 | */
263 | public AutofitHelper addOnTextSizeChangeListener(OnTextSizeChangeListener listener) {
264 | if (mListeners == null) {
265 | mListeners = new ArrayList();
266 | }
267 | mListeners.add(listener);
268 | return this;
269 | }
270 |
271 | /**
272 | * Removes the specified {@link OnTextSizeChangeListener} from the list of those whose methods
273 | * are called whenever the {@link TextView}'s {@code textSize} changes.
274 | */
275 | public AutofitHelper removeOnTextSizeChangeListener(OnTextSizeChangeListener listener) {
276 | if (mListeners != null) {
277 | mListeners.remove(listener);
278 | }
279 | return this;
280 | }
281 |
282 | /**
283 | * Returns the amount of precision used to calculate the correct text size to fit within its
284 | * bounds.
285 | */
286 | public float getPrecision() {
287 | return mPrecision;
288 | }
289 |
290 | /**
291 | * Set the amount of precision used to calculate the correct text size to fit within its
292 | * bounds. Lower precision is more precise and takes more time.
293 | *
294 | * @param precision The amount of precision.
295 | */
296 | public AutofitHelper setPrecision(float precision) {
297 | if (mPrecision != precision) {
298 | mPrecision = precision;
299 |
300 | autofit();
301 | }
302 | return this;
303 | }
304 |
305 | /**
306 | * Returns the minimum size (in pixels) of the text.
307 | */
308 | public float getMinTextSize() {
309 | return mMinTextSize;
310 | }
311 |
312 | /**
313 | * Set the minimum text size to the given value, interpreted as "scaled pixel" units. This size
314 | * is adjusted based on the current density and user font size preference.
315 | *
316 | * @param size The scaled pixel size.
317 | *
318 | * @attr ref me.grantland.R.styleable#AutofitTextView_minTextSize
319 | */
320 | public AutofitHelper setMinTextSize(float size) {
321 | return setMinTextSize(TypedValue.COMPLEX_UNIT_SP, size);
322 | }
323 |
324 | /**
325 | * Set the minimum text size to a given unit and value. See TypedValue for the possible
326 | * dimension units.
327 | *
328 | * @param unit The desired dimension unit.
329 | * @param size The desired size in the given units.
330 | *
331 | * @attr ref me.grantland.R.styleable#AutofitTextView_minTextSize
332 | */
333 | public AutofitHelper setMinTextSize(int unit, float size) {
334 | Context context = mTextView.getContext();
335 | Resources r = Resources.getSystem();
336 |
337 | if (context != null) {
338 | r = context.getResources();
339 | }
340 |
341 | setRawMinTextSize(TypedValue.applyDimension(unit, size, r.getDisplayMetrics()));
342 | return this;
343 | }
344 |
345 | private void setRawMinTextSize(float size) {
346 | if (size != mMinTextSize) {
347 | mMinTextSize = size;
348 |
349 | autofit();
350 | }
351 | }
352 |
353 | /**
354 | * Returns the maximum size (in pixels) of the text.
355 | */
356 | public float getMaxTextSize() {
357 | return mMaxTextSize;
358 | }
359 |
360 | /**
361 | * Set the maximum text size to the given value, interpreted as "scaled pixel" units. This size
362 | * is adjusted based on the current density and user font size preference.
363 | *
364 | * @param size The scaled pixel size.
365 | *
366 | * @attr ref android.R.styleable#TextView_textSize
367 | */
368 | public AutofitHelper setMaxTextSize(float size) {
369 | return setMaxTextSize(TypedValue.COMPLEX_UNIT_SP, size);
370 | }
371 |
372 | /**
373 | * Set the maximum text size to a given unit and value. See TypedValue for the possible
374 | * dimension units.
375 | *
376 | * @param unit The desired dimension unit.
377 | * @param size The desired size in the given units.
378 | *
379 | * @attr ref android.R.styleable#TextView_textSize
380 | */
381 | public AutofitHelper setMaxTextSize(int unit, float size) {
382 | Context context = mTextView.getContext();
383 | Resources r = Resources.getSystem();
384 |
385 | if (context != null) {
386 | r = context.getResources();
387 | }
388 |
389 | setRawMaxTextSize(TypedValue.applyDimension(unit, size, r.getDisplayMetrics()));
390 | return this;
391 | }
392 |
393 | private void setRawMaxTextSize(float size) {
394 | if (size != mMaxTextSize) {
395 | mMaxTextSize = size;
396 |
397 | autofit();
398 | }
399 | }
400 |
401 | /**
402 | * @see TextView#getMaxLines()
403 | */
404 | public int getMaxLines() {
405 | return mMaxLines;
406 | }
407 |
408 | /**
409 | * @see TextView#setMaxLines(int)
410 | */
411 | public AutofitHelper setMaxLines(int lines) {
412 | if (mMaxLines != lines) {
413 | mMaxLines = lines;
414 |
415 | autofit();
416 | }
417 | return this;
418 | }
419 |
420 | /**
421 | * Returns whether or not automatically resizing text is enabled.
422 | */
423 | public boolean isEnabled() {
424 | return mEnabled;
425 | }
426 |
427 | /**
428 | * Set the enabled state of automatically resizing text.
429 | */
430 | public AutofitHelper setEnabled(boolean enabled) {
431 | if (mEnabled != enabled) {
432 | mEnabled = enabled;
433 |
434 | if (enabled) {
435 | mTextView.addTextChangedListener(mTextWatcher);
436 | mTextView.addOnLayoutChangeListener(mOnLayoutChangeListener);
437 |
438 | autofit();
439 | } else {
440 | mTextView.removeTextChangedListener(mTextWatcher);
441 | mTextView.removeOnLayoutChangeListener(mOnLayoutChangeListener);
442 |
443 | mTextView.setTextSize(TypedValue.COMPLEX_UNIT_PX, mTextSize);
444 | }
445 | }
446 | return this;
447 | }
448 |
449 | /**
450 | * Returns the original text size of the View.
451 | *
452 | * @see TextView#getTextSize()
453 | */
454 | public float getTextSize() {
455 | return mTextSize;
456 | }
457 |
458 | /**
459 | * Set the original text size of the View.
460 | *
461 | * @see TextView#setTextSize(float)
462 | */
463 | public void setTextSize(float size) {
464 | setTextSize(TypedValue.COMPLEX_UNIT_SP, size);
465 | }
466 |
467 | /**
468 | * Set the original text size of the View.
469 | *
470 | * @see TextView#setTextSize(int, float)
471 | */
472 | public void setTextSize(int unit, float size) {
473 | if (mIsAutofitting) {
474 | // We don't want to update the TextView's actual textSize while we're autofitting
475 | // since it'd get set to the autofitTextSize
476 | return;
477 | }
478 | Context context = mTextView.getContext();
479 | Resources r = Resources.getSystem();
480 |
481 | if (context != null) {
482 | r = context.getResources();
483 | }
484 |
485 | setRawTextSize(TypedValue.applyDimension(unit, size, r.getDisplayMetrics()));
486 | }
487 |
488 | private void setRawTextSize(float size) {
489 | if (mTextSize != size) {
490 | mTextSize = size;
491 | }
492 | }
493 |
494 | private void autofit() {
495 | float oldTextSize = mTextView.getTextSize();
496 | float textSize;
497 |
498 | mIsAutofitting = true;
499 | autofit(mTextView, mPaint, mMinTextSize, mMaxTextSize, mMaxLines, mPrecision);
500 | mIsAutofitting = false;
501 |
502 | textSize = mTextView.getTextSize();
503 | if (textSize != oldTextSize) {
504 | sendTextSizeChange(textSize, oldTextSize);
505 | }
506 | }
507 |
508 | private void sendTextSizeChange(float textSize, float oldTextSize) {
509 | if (mListeners == null) {
510 | return;
511 | }
512 |
513 | for (OnTextSizeChangeListener listener : mListeners) {
514 | listener.onTextSizeChange(textSize, oldTextSize);
515 | }
516 | }
517 |
518 | private class AutofitTextWatcher implements TextWatcher {
519 | @Override
520 | public void beforeTextChanged(CharSequence charSequence, int start, int count, int after) {
521 | // do nothing
522 | }
523 |
524 | @Override
525 | public void onTextChanged(CharSequence charSequence, int start, int before, int count) {
526 | autofit();
527 | }
528 |
529 | @Override
530 | public void afterTextChanged(Editable editable) {
531 | // do nothing
532 | }
533 | }
534 |
535 | private class AutofitOnLayoutChangeListener implements View.OnLayoutChangeListener {
536 | @Override
537 | public void onLayoutChange(View view, int left, int top, int right, int bottom,
538 | int oldLeft, int oldTop, int oldRight, int oldBottom) {
539 | autofit();
540 | }
541 | }
542 |
543 | /**
544 | * When an object of a type is attached to an {@code AutofitHelper}, its methods will be called
545 | * when the {@code textSize} is changed.
546 | */
547 | public interface OnTextSizeChangeListener {
548 | /**
549 | * This method is called to notify you that the size of the text has changed to
550 | * {@code textSize} from {@code oldTextSize}.
551 | */
552 | public void onTextSizeChange(float textSize, float oldTextSize);
553 | }
554 | }
555 |

/library/src/main/java/me/grantland/widget/AutofitTextView.java: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| package me.grantland.widget;
2 |
3 | import android.content.Context;
4 | import android.util.AttributeSet;
5 | import android.util.TypedValue;
6 | import android.widget.TextView;
7 |
8 | /**
9 | * A {@link TextView} that re-sizes its text to be no larger than the width of the view.
10 | *
11 | * @attr ref R.styleable.AutofitTextView_sizeToFit
12 | * @attr ref R.styleable.AutofitTextView_minTextSize
13 | * @attr ref R.styleable.AutofitTextView_precision
14 | */
15 | public class AutofitTextView extends TextView implements AutofitHelper.OnTextSizeChangeListener {
16 |
17 | private AutofitHelper mHelper;
18 |
19 | public AutofitTextView(Context context) {
20 | super(context);
21 | init(context, null, 0);
22 | }
23 |
24 | public AutofitTextView(Context context, AttributeSet attrs) {
25 | super(context, attrs);
26 | init(context, attrs, 0);
27 | }
28 |
29 | public AutofitTextView(Context context, AttributeSet attrs, int defStyle) {
30 | super(context, attrs, defStyle);
31 | init(context, attrs, defStyle);
32 | }
33 |
34 | private void init(Context context, AttributeSet attrs, int defStyle) {
35 | mHelper = AutofitHelper.create(this, attrs, defStyle)
36 | .addOnTextSizeChangeListener(this);
37 | }
38 |
39 | // Getters and Setters
40 |
41 | /**
42 | * {@inheritDoc}
43 | */
44 | @Override
45 | public void setTextSize(int unit, float size) {
46 | super.setTextSize(unit, size);
47 | if (mHelper != null) {
48 | mHelper.setTextSize(unit, size);
49 | }
50 | }
51 |
52 | /**
53 | * {@inheritDoc}
54 | */
55 | @Override
56 | public void setLines(int lines) {
57 | super.setLines(lines);
58 | if (mHelper != null) {
59 | mHelper.setMaxLines(lines);
60 | }
61 | }
62 |
63 | /**
64 | * {@inheritDoc}
65 | */
66 | @Override
67 | public void setMaxLines(int maxLines) {
68 | super.setMaxLines(maxLines);
69 | if (mHelper != null) {
70 | mHelper.setMaxLines(maxLines);
71 | }
72 | }
73 |
74 | /**
75 | * Returns the {@link AutofitHelper} for this View.
76 | */
77 | public AutofitHelper getAutofitHelper() {
78 | return mHelper;
79 | }
80 |
81 | /**
82 | * Returns whether or not the text will be automatically re-sized to fit its constraints.
83 | */
84 | public boolean isSizeToFit() {
85 | return mHelper.isEnabled();
86 | }
87 |
88 | /**
89 | * Sets the property of this field (sizeToFit), to automatically resize the text to fit its
90 | * constraints.
91 | */
92 | public void setSizeToFit() {
93 | setSizeToFit(true);
94 | }
95 |
96 | /**
97 | * If true, the text will automatically be re-sized to fit its constraints; if false, it will
98 | * act like a normal TextView.
99 | *
100 | * @param sizeToFit
101 | */
102 | public void setSizeToFit(boolean sizeToFit) {
103 | mHelper.setEnabled(sizeToFit);
104 | }
105 |
106 | /**
107 | * Returns the maximum size (in pixels) of the text in this View.
108 | */
109 | public float getMaxTextSize() {
110 | return mHelper.getMaxTextSize();
111 | }
112 |
113 | /**
114 | * Set the maximum text size to the given value, interpreted as "scaled pixel" units. This size
115 | * is adjusted based on the current density and user font size preference.
116 | *
117 | * @param size The scaled pixel size.
118 | *
119 | * @attr ref android.R.styleable#TextView_textSize
120 | */
121 | public void setMaxTextSize(float size) {
122 | mHelper.setMaxTextSize(size);
123 | }
124 |
125 | /**
126 | * Set the maximum text size to a given unit and value. See TypedValue for the possible
127 | * dimension units.
128 | *
129 | * @param unit The desired dimension unit.
130 | * @param size The desired size in the given units.
131 | *
132 | * @attr ref android.R.styleable#TextView_textSize
133 | */
134 | public void setMaxTextSize(int unit, float size) {
135 | mHelper.setMaxTextSize(unit, size);
136 | }
137 |
138 | /**
139 | * Returns the minimum size (in pixels) of the text in this View.
140 | */
141 | public float getMinTextSize() {
142 | return mHelper.getMinTextSize();
143 | }
144 |
145 | /**
146 | * Set the minimum text size to the given value, interpreted as "scaled pixel" units. This size
147 | * is adjusted based on the current density and user font size preference.
148 | *
149 | * @param minSize The scaled pixel size.
150 | *
151 | * @attr ref me.grantland.R.styleable#AutofitTextView_minTextSize
152 | */
153 | public void setMinTextSize(int minSize) {
154 | mHelper.setMinTextSize(TypedValue.COMPLEX_UNIT_SP, minSize);
155 | }
156 |
157 | /**
158 | * Set the minimum text size to a given unit and value. See TypedValue for the possible
159 | * dimension units.
160 | *
161 | * @param unit The desired dimension unit.
162 | * @param minSize The desired size in the given units.
163 | *
164 | * @attr ref me.grantland.R.styleable#AutofitTextView_minTextSize
165 | */
166 | public void setMinTextSize(int unit, float minSize) {
167 | mHelper.setMinTextSize(unit, minSize);
168 | }
169 |
170 | /**
171 | * Returns the amount of precision used to calculate the correct text size to fit within its
172 | * bounds.
173 | */
174 | public float getPrecision() {
175 | return mHelper.getPrecision();
176 | }
177 |
178 | /**
179 | * Set the amount of precision used to calculate the correct text size to fit within its
180 | * bounds. Lower precision is more precise and takes more time.
181 | *
182 | * @param precision The amount of precision.
183 | */
184 | public void setPrecision(float precision) {
185 | mHelper.setPrecision(precision);
186 | }
187 |
188 | @Override
189 | public void onTextSizeChange(float textSize, float oldTextSize) {
190 | // do nothing
191 | }
192 | }
193 |
